> > yes. Only the UDC driver knows when the controller is moving among those
> > states.
> 
> Not quite.  Only the gadget driver knows when the transition between 
> ADDRESS and CONFIGURED occurs.  This should be added to composite.c.

that's not entirely true :-) See how we handle that in dwc3:

| static int dwc3_ep0_set_config(struct dwc3 *dwc, struct usb_ctrlrequest *ctrl)
| {
|       enum usb_device_state state = dwc->gadget.state;
|       u32 cfg;
|       int ret;
|       u32 reg;
| 
|       dwc->start_config_issued = false;
|       cfg = le16_to_cpu(ctrl->wValue);
| 
|       switch (state) {
|       case USB_STATE_DEFAULT:
|               return -EINVAL;
|               break;
| 
|       case USB_STATE_ADDRESS:
|               ret = dwc3_ep0_delegate_req(dwc, ctrl);
|               /* if the cfg matches and the cfg is non zero */
|               if (cfg && (!ret || (ret == USB_GADGET_DELAYED_STATUS))) {
|                       usb_gadget_set_state(&dwc->gadget,
|                                       USB_STATE_CONFIGURED);
| 
|                       /*
|                        * Enable transition to U1/U2 state when
|                        * nothing is pending from application.
|                        */
|                       reg = dwc3_readl(dwc->regs, DWC3_DCTL);
|                       reg |= (DWC3_DCTL_ACCEPTU1ENA | DWC3_DCTL_ACCEPTU2ENA);
|                       dwc3_writel(dwc->regs, DWC3_DCTL, reg);
| 
|                       dwc->resize_fifos = true;
|                       dev_dbg(dwc->dev, "resize fifos flag SET\n");
|               }
|               break;
| 
|       case USB_STATE_CONFIGURED:
|               ret = dwc3_ep0_delegate_req(dwc, ctrl);
|               if (!cfg)
|                       usb_gadget_set_state(&dwc->gadget,
|                                       USB_STATE_ADDRESS);
|               break;
|       default:
|               ret = -EINVAL;
|       }
|       return ret;
| }

Also, until other gadget drivers add notifications to the other cases, I
don't think it's wise to add a transition from NOTATTACHED to
CONFIGURED.
